Mr Eazi, a popular Nigerian artist, and his fiancée, Temi Otedola, a millionaire heiress, have hinted that they will marry in an intimate ceremony with few guests.
The couple, who just announced their engagement, revealed this in a podcast interview about their engagement and wedding planning.
Mr. Eazi expressed his desire for a small wedding with only close family members in attendance, and his future wife-to-be concurred, stating that she, too, would like an intimate wedding because she is a very private person.
Temi claims that if she had her way, she would only invite ten guests to their wedding. “Knowing me, if I’m strolling through my wedding venue and I don’t recognize this individual, it’ll irritate me because I’m a very private person.” Temi backed up her partner’s statements by saying, “Even for a birthday celebration, I have to really rock with everyone there…”
Their parents, too, are quite private people, according to the couple. Temi’s father, Femi Otedola, a millionaire businessman, proposed they have a small wedding at the mansion, according to the report.
